Following a thorough safety and efficacy assessment, Health Canada has concluded that irradiation is a safe and effective treatment to reduce harmful bacteria in fresh and frozen raw ground beef. Health Canada is proceeding with amendments to the Food and Drug Regulations that will permit the sale of irradiated fresh and frozen raw ground beef. The new regulations will be posted in the Canada Gazette, Part II, on February 22, 2017.
